The Role of Pesticides Testing Labs in Food Safety

Pesticides are used widely across the globe in farming to protect crops from pests, fungi, and other agricultural threats. However, when these chemicals are not used properly, or when the pesticides exceed safe limits, they can remain in food and agricultural products. These residues can be harmful to human health, especially when consumed over a long period.

Pesticides Testing Labs play a critical role in ensuring food safety by testing agricultural products for pesticide residues. These labs perform highly sensitive tests to detect even trace amounts of pesticides in food items such as fruits, vegetables, grains, and processed products. The testing is essential to ensure that the pesticide levels in food do not exceed the maximum residue limits (MRLs) set by regulatory authorities, such as the Food and Drug Administration (FDA), World Health Organization (WHO), and European Food Safety Authority (EFSA).

By carrying out these essential tests, pesticides testing labs ensure that consumers are not exposed to harmful chemicals that could pose long-term health risks.


How Pesticides Testing Labs Prevent Long-Term Health Risks

  1. Early Detection of Harmful Pesticide Levels

Pesticides are designed to be toxic to pests, but they can also affect humans when consumed in large amounts. Chronic exposure to pesticide residues in food has been linked to various health issues, including:

  • Cancer: Certain pesticides, such as organophosphates, have been classified as potential carcinogens.

  • Hormonal Disruption: Some pesticides, like neonicotinoids, can interfere with the body's endocrine system, leading to hormonal imbalances.

  • Neurological Disorders: Prolonged exposure to certain pesticides can affect the nervous system, leading to conditions such as Parkinson’s disease.

Pesticides Testing Labs use advanced techniques like Gas Chromatography-Mass Spectrometry (GC-MS) and Liquid Chromatography-Mass Spectrometry (LC-MS/MS) to detect pesticide residues even in trace amounts. These tests are capable of identifying the most commonly used pesticides and ensuring that they do not exceed the permissible limits established by health authorities. Early detection of harmful pesticide levels prevents food products with unsafe residue levels from reaching the market, thereby protecting public health from long-term exposure to dangerous chemicals.


  1. Ensuring Compliance with Safety Standards

International and national food safety regulations mandate that the use of pesticides in agricultural practices is closely monitored. Regulatory bodies set Maximum Residue Limits (MRLs) for pesticides, which are the highest levels of pesticide residues legally allowed in food or feed. Pesticides Testing Labs help ensure that these limits are not exceeded by conducting regular tests on agricultural products before they are sold to consumers or exported.

  • Regulatory Compliance: Testing labs ensure that all products comply with local and international standards. For example, the European Union (EU) has strict pesticide residue limits that are enforced through regular testing of imported products. Similarly, countries like the United States and India have their own stringent pesticide regulations.

  • Prevention of Health Hazards: By adhering to these safety standards, testing labs help prevent consumers from unknowingly ingesting food that could have harmful long-term effects. Testing labs provide certificates of analysis that verify pesticide levels and assure consumers that products meet safety standards.


  1. Protection of Vulnerable Populations

Some groups of people, such as children, pregnant women, the elderly, and individuals with compromised immune systems, are particularly sensitive to the effects of pesticides. Chronic exposure to pesticide residues may increase the risk of developmental and reproductive issues in children or cause birth defects during pregnancy. Pesticides Testing Labs play an essential role in safeguarding these vulnerable groups by ensuring that food products are free from dangerous pesticide residues.

For example, children who consume fruits and vegetables with pesticide residues may be at greater risk due to their smaller size and developing systems. Pregnant women can also be vulnerable to pesticide exposure, which may affect both the mother and the fetus. Testing labs regularly test food products consumed by these groups to ensure that they are safe and free from harmful chemicals, reducing the risk of long-term health issues.


  1. Monitoring Long-Term Trends in Pesticide Use

Regular monitoring and testing of pesticide residues also help authorities and researchers track long-term trends in pesticide use across the agricultural sector. This data allows them to:

  • Identify Overuse of Certain Pesticides: Over-reliance on specific pesticides can lead to residues accumulating in food products over time, increasing the risk of chronic exposure. By tracking pesticide use and residue levels, testing labs help identify areas where pesticide use needs to be reduced or replaced with safer alternatives.

  • Encourage Safer Farming Practices: The data collected by testing labs can also be used to promote integrated pest management (IPM) practices, which focus on using fewer chemical pesticides and relying more on biological and natural control methods. This approach reduces the overall pesticide load on food crops, minimizing the health risks associated with pesticide exposure.


  1. Supporting Organic Farming and Sustainable Agriculture

The growing trend towards organic farming and sustainable agriculture is an effort to reduce pesticide use in food production. Organic farming bans the use of synthetic pesticides, but it still requires rigorous monitoring to ensure that no prohibited chemicals have been used. Pesticides Testing Labs are key in certifying organic produce, ensuring that food products meet organic standards and do not contain harmful pesticide residues. By offering testing services for organic certification, these labs help maintain the integrity of organic farming and protect consumers from long-term exposure to synthetic pesticides.

Sustainable agriculture practices, such as crop rotation, soil health management, and the use of natural predators, are increasingly being adopted to reduce the dependency on chemical pesticides. Testing labs support these efforts by ensuring that the levels of pesticide residues remain well within safe limits, thus promoting a healthier, more sustainable agricultural system.
